Risk Management Guidelines for Churches
Risk Management-includes the basic steps required
to manage a risk successfully. It is more cost effective to
prevent losses than to manage losses.
Basic Steps:
- IDENTIFY the Church's human and physical
resources and how they are exposed to accidents and loss,
- Take ACTION to eliminate or minimize the
possibility of accidents or loss and
- Determine the extent of financial protection
required.
Risk Control / Loss Prevention is a key element
of Church Management and for churches it involves a deep and
ongoing concern for -
- PROTECTING PEOPLE from accidents and injury
- PREVENTING destruction of church property
- SECURITY from theft, arson and vandalism
- SAFE TRANSPORTATION for children and adults
- CONSERVING energy and other resources
